Concrete block repair services address the restoration and reinforcement of damaged or deteriorating concrete blocks on residential properties. These services are commonly requested for projects such as repairing foundation walls, retaining walls, basement walls, or decorative block features that have experienced cracks, crumbling, or shifting over time. Property owners should understand the extent of damage, the type of concrete blocks involved, and whether the repairs involve simple patching or more extensive structural reinforcement to ensure the stability and safety of the area.
Before requesting concrete block repair, homeowners often want to know the causes of damage, the materials used for repairs, and the longevity of the solutions provided. It’s also helpful to consider the overall condition of the existing blocks and whether repairs will match the original appearance or require additional finishing. Clear assessment of the scope of work and understanding of potential costs can aid property owners in making informed decisions for maintaining the integrity and appearance of their property’s concrete structures.

Concrete Block Repair Questions
What causes concrete block damage? Damage can result from settling, moisture infiltration, or impact, leading to cracks or looseness in blocks.
How are concrete blocks repaired? Repairs typically involve removing damaged blocks, cleaning the area, and replacing or reinforcing with new blocks or mortar.
Is repair necessary for minor cracks? Yes, even small cracks should be addressed to prevent further deterioration and maintain structural integrity.
What types of projects involve concrete block repair? Common projects include foundation wall fixes, retaining wall repairs, and restoring decorative or boundary walls.
